from the photographer: “While traveling in Israel, I was privileged to photograph this sweet and fun loving couple. We met at an isolated beach close to Haifa, Israel. An hour north of Tel Aviv, Haifa is most known for its iconic beautiful Baha’i  gardens— extending from the summit of Mount Carmel. Minutes away is the Coast of Israel with beaches overlooking the Mediterranean Sea. The beach we decided to meet at had views of ruins of a crusader castle just yards away. Ben is from Vancouver Island in Canada and Tahirih is Canadian born and raised in China. They met while volunteering at the Baha’i World Centre in Haifa and became friends right away. Over the next year, they began to realize that a life together was something they’d like to work towards. Their plans were to have a small private ceremony in Haifa and shortly after move back to Canada to begin the next chapter of their lives. “

Tell us about your outfit choices and details! 
Our rings are made from gold melted down from two heirloom pieces of jewelry. They are sand cast, with a pocketed exterior, while the interior is polished and smooth. Each grain of said leaves an indentation. This was important to us, as the sand came from a beach in Akká. This city is held very dear to us as Baha’is, and it was on these beaches only 200 years ago that Baháʼu’lláh walked these shores.
